What is the Ruling Planet of Pisces?
When it comes to astrology, the ruling planet of a zodiac sign plays a crucial role in shaping its characteristics, strengths, and vulnerabilities. For Pisces, the answer to "what is the ruling planet of Pisces?" is both fascinating and complex. Pisces is unique in the zodiac because it has a dual rulership, with Neptune being its modern ruler and Jupiter its traditional ruler. This dual influence creates a rich tapestry of energies that define the Piscean personality.
Neptune, often referred to as the planet of dreams, illusions, and spirituality, is the modern ruler of Pisces. Its influence brings an ethereal quality to Pisces, making them highly intuitive, imaginative, and sensitive. Neptune's energy encourages Pisceans to explore the depths of their subconscious and connect with the spiritual realm. This connection often manifests in their artistic talents, empathetic nature, and ability to see beyond the material world.
On the other hand, Jupiter, the planet of expansion, wisdom, and abundance, serves as the traditional ruler of Pisces. Jupiter's influence adds a sense of optimism, generosity, and a thirst for knowledge to the Piscean personality. It drives them to seek higher truths, explore philosophical ideas, and embrace life's adventures with an open heart. Together, Neptune and Jupiter create a harmonious blend of mysticism and growth, shaping Pisces into a sign that is both deeply spiritual and endlessly curious about the world around them.

Why is Neptune Considered the Modern Ruler of Pisces?
Neptune's designation as the modern ruler of Pisces stems from its profound alignment with the sign's core characteristics and themes. In traditional astrology, Jupiter was considered the sole ruler of Pisces, but with the discovery of Neptune in 1846, astrologers recognized its uncanny resonance with the sign's mystical and intuitive nature. Neptune, often referred to as the planet of dreams and illusions, perfectly encapsulates the ethereal and otherworldly qualities that define Pisces. Its association with spirituality, creativity, and the subconscious makes it a natural fit for this water sign, which is deeply connected to emotions and the unseen realms.
One of the reasons Neptune is considered the modern ruler of Pisces lies in its ability to amplify the sign's sensitivity and compassion. Pisceans are known for their empathetic nature, and Neptune's influence heightens this trait, allowing them to feel and absorb the emotions of others. This connection also explains why Pisceans often gravitate toward artistic and creative pursuits, as Neptune's energy fuels their imagination and inspires them to express their inner world through various mediums. Moreover, Neptune's link to spirituality aligns seamlessly with Pisces' quest for higher meaning and transcendence, further solidifying its role as the modern ruler.
The shift from Jupiter to Neptune as the primary ruler of Pisces reflects the evolution of astrological understanding over time. While Jupiter remains a significant influence, Neptune's discovery brought a deeper layer of insight into the complexities of Pisces. By recognizing Neptune's modern rulership, astrologers can more accurately interpret the nuances of this sign and its unique relationship with the cosmos.
